SQL Server Administração

Monitoramento de bloqueio de processo no banco de dados SQL Server.

Monitoramento de bloqueio de processo no banco de dados SQL Server
Monitoramento de bloqueio de processo no banco de dados SQL Server

Faça um monitoramento de bloqueio de processos no seu banco de dados SQL Server.

O que acha de receber um email de alerta de bloqueio de processo do seu banco de dados?

Email bloqueio de processsos SQL Server
Email bloqueio de processsos SQL Server

Descobrir quais consultas estão bloqueando processos importantes no ambiente SQL Server é sempre um desafio para o DBA, existem várias formas de você descobrir quais consultas estão bloqueando outras no SQL Server.

O problema é que dependendo da estratégia que você adotar para buscar essas informações, em alguns casos fica bem custoso descobrir, então ao invés de ir atrás dessas informações, deixe que o SQL Server envie as informações para você, com essas informações, você poderá atuar diretamente no problema poupando finalmente tempo no seu dia.

O monitoramento de bloqueio de processos que eu criei nesta versão é bem simples, basicamente um job executando a cada dois minutos faz um snapshot de todos os processos no banco de dados, caso tenha algum bloqueio de processo com mais de um minuto em execução, uma email será enviado para você com todos os detalhes que precisa saber.

Informações no email de alerta do bloqueio de processo:

  • Horário do bloqueio do processo.
  • Nome do banco de dados.
  • Tempo em que a sessão está aberta.
  • ID da transação bloqueador (ofensor).
  • ID da transação que está sendo bloqueado.
  • Login.
  • Hostname.

Neste momento são informações muito básicas para esta versão, que em breve estarei lançando novas versões com mais detalhes e informações que poderão ajudar cada vez mais.

Para instalar basta seguir os passos que estão em um arquivo chamado INSTRUÇÕES DE INSTALAÇÃO. É bem simples de instalar. Em breve estarei lançando um vídeo também mostrando como configurar algumas coisas como por exemplo o tempo de bloqueio caso você queira diminuir ou aumentar.

Os arquivos para baixar podem ser encontrados no link abaixo. Em caso de dúvidas ou problemas entre em contato comigo.

Monitoramento de bloqueio de processo no banco de dados SQL Server.
The following two tabs change content below.

Wesley Mota

DBA SQL Server
Profissional graduado em Banco de Dados e Sistemas de Informação com mais de 7 anos de experiência em empresas de software. Certificado MCSA Microsoft SQL Server possui intensa vivência em administração de banco de dados, Tunning, Performance SQL Server, levantamento de melhorias e monitoramento de banco de dados e servidores SQL Server. Consultoria SQL Server em diversos clientes no Brasil e ao redor do mundo. Escritor no blog dbasqlserverbr.com.br/blog. Onde compartilha conhecimento, experiências e dicas de performance para DBAs SQL Server. Conhecimentos em Oracle e ambientes de alta disponibilidade. Desenvolvimento de softwares web e mobile.Gerenciamento de equipe e projetos.

Latest posts by Wesley Mota (see all)